Rubén Abella

Rubén Abella is the author of six novels —Dice la sangre [Blood Speaks] (winner of the Castilla-León Critics Award in 2025), Ictus [Stroke] (2020), California (2015), Baruc en el río [Baruc in the River] (2011), El libro del amor esquivo [The Book of Elusive Love] (finalist of the prestigious Nadal prize in 2009), and La sombra del escapista [The Shadow of the Escape Artist] (winner of the Torrente Ballester prize in 2002)—; a book of short stories —Quince llamadas perdidas [Fifteen Missed Calls] (winner of the Kutxa prize in 2020), and two collections of flash fiction — Los ojos de los peces [Fish Eyes] (2010) and No habría sido igual sin la luvia [It Wouldn’t Have Been the Same Without the Rain] (winner of the Mario Vargas Llosa NH prize in 2007)—. He is also a photographer and a teacher at Escuela de Escritores and Universidad Pontificia Comillas in Madrid. (Teacher International writing course 2025).
